The Species Conservation Program was created to encourage people and organizations to get involved in conserving species at risk and their habitats through stewardship activities. It’s part of Ontario’s track record of strong environmental stewardship, preserving the rich biodiversity of our province for future generations.

Eligibility

The fund is open to individuals and groups across Ontario, including:

To be eligible for consideration, conservation projects must benefit species that have been assessed by the Committee on the Status of Species at Risk in Ontario (COSSARO) as extirpated, endangered, threatened or of special concern.
